Historical Neighborhood
The buildings surrounding the White House and Lafayette Park illustrate the growth of the nation’s capital from its early years to the present day and reflect a variety of architectural trends and styles. Pierre L’Enfant’s plans for the city included President’s Park, later named for the Marquis de Lafayette. St. John’s Church dates from 1816, and pew 54 is reserved for the president. The Blair House built in 1824, accommodates visiting heads of state. The Old Executive Office Building, a block away, was originally built to house the State, War and Navy Departments and is an excellent example of the lavish architectural and decorative taste of the late 1800s. The New Executive Office Building is on H Street directly across from Lafayette Tower.
